
如何编辑图片中数据库
编辑图片中的数据库有以下几种方法:使用OCR技术转换图片为文本、手动输入数据、使用专业的软件进行图像处理。 其中,最常用的方法是使用OCR(Optical Character Recognition,光学字符识别)技术,它可以将图片中的文字内容识别并转换为可编辑的文本形式。OCR技术具有高效、准确的特点,能够大大节省人工录入的时间和精力。
一、OCR技术的应用
OCR技术是将扫描的文档或图片中的文字转换为机器可读的文本数据的技术。它的应用非常广泛,包括文件数字化、文档管理、以及图片中的数据库编辑等。利用OCR技术,可以快速准确地将图片中的文字内容提取出来,并进行编辑和管理。
1、OCR技术的工作原理
OCR技术的工作原理主要包括以下几个步骤:
- 图像预处理:包括去噪、二值化、倾斜校正等,提高图像质量,为后续的文字识别做准备。
- 文字识别:通过特征提取和模式匹配,将图像中的文字转换为对应的字符。
- 后处理:对识别结果进行语法和语义分析,修正识别错误,提高识别准确性。
2、常用的OCR软件和工具
市面上有很多优秀的OCR软件和工具,如:
- Adobe Acrobat:支持PDF文件的OCR功能,能够将扫描的文档转换为可编辑的文本。
- Tesseract:开源的OCR引擎,支持多种语言,具有较高的识别精度。
- ABBYY FineReader:专业的OCR软件,支持多种文档格式,具有强大的文字识别和编辑功能。
二、手动输入数据
在某些情况下,OCR技术可能无法完全准确地识别图片中的文字内容,特别是对于复杂的表格、公式或手写文字。这时,手动输入数据仍然是必要的。
1、数据整理和录入
手动输入数据时,首先需要对图片中的数据进行整理,确保数据的完整和准确。可以将数据分类整理,方便后续的录入和编辑。
2、数据库管理工具
使用数据库管理工具,可以更高效地进行数据录入和管理。例如:
- Microsoft Excel:适用于小规模数据的录入和管理,支持多种数据格式和函数。
- MySQL Workbench:适用于大规模数据的管理和查询,提供图形化的界面和强大的功能。
- SQLite:轻量级的数据库管理工具,适用于嵌入式系统和移动设备。
三、专业软件进行图像处理
对于一些特殊的图片数据库,可能需要使用专业的软件进行图像处理和数据提取。
1、图像处理软件
使用图像处理软件可以对图片进行编辑和优化,提高数据识别的准确性。例如:
- Adobe Photoshop:专业的图像处理软件,支持多种图像格式和编辑功能。
- GIMP:开源的图像处理软件,具有强大的图像编辑功能。
- CorelDRAW:适用于矢量图形的编辑和处理。
2、数据提取和分析
通过图像处理软件对图片进行预处理后,可以使用数据提取和分析工具对数据进行提取和分析。例如:
- Tableau:数据可视化工具,支持多种数据源和可视化图表。
- Power BI:微软推出的数据分析和可视化工具,支持多种数据源和分析功能。
- Python:通过编写脚本和使用库(如Pandas、NumPy等)进行数据提取和分析。
四、结合多种方法
在实际应用中,可能需要结合多种方法来编辑图片中的数据库。可以先使用OCR技术进行初步的文字识别,然后手动校对和补充数据,最后使用专业的软件进行数据处理和分析。
1、提高数据准确性
为了提高数据的准确性,可以采用以下几种方法:
- 多次识别:使用不同的OCR软件进行多次识别,取其交集或并集,提高识别准确性。
- 校对和验证:对识别结果进行人工校对和验证,确保数据的准确性。
- 数据清洗和处理:对识别结果进行数据清洗和处理,去除噪声和冗余数据。
2、提高工作效率
为了提高工作效率,可以采用以下几种方法:
- 批量处理:使用批处理工具,对大量图片进行批量处理,提高工作效率。
- 自动化脚本:编写自动化脚本,实现数据的自动提取和处理,减少人工干预。
- 协作工具:使用项目管理和协作工具(如研发项目管理系统PingCode、通用项目协作软件Worktile),提高团队协作效率和数据管理水平。
五、数据安全和隐私保护
在编辑图片中的数据库时,还需要注意数据的安全和隐私保护。特别是对于包含敏感信息的数据,需要采取适当的措施进行保护。
1、数据加密
对敏感数据进行加密,确保数据在传输和存储过程中的安全。可以使用对称加密和非对称加密算法,如AES、RSA等。
2、访问控制
设置合理的访问控制策略,确保只有授权人员才能访问和编辑数据。可以使用基于角色的访问控制(RBAC)和基于属性的访问控制(ABAC)等策略。
3、数据备份和恢复
定期对数据进行备份,确保在数据丢失或损坏时能够快速恢复。可以使用本地备份和云备份相结合的方式,提高数据的安全性和可用性。
六、案例分析
为了更好地理解如何编辑图片中的数据库,可以通过一些实际的案例进行分析。
1、医疗影像数据的处理
在医疗领域,常常需要对医疗影像数据进行处理和分析。通过OCR技术,可以将医疗影像中的文字内容提取出来,并进行结构化存储和分析。例如,可以将病理报告中的文字内容提取出来,存储在数据库中,方便医生进行查询和分析。
2、历史文档的数字化
在历史文档的数字化过程中,常常需要对扫描的文档进行文字识别和编辑。通过OCR技术,可以将历史文档中的文字内容提取出来,并进行数字化存储和管理。例如,可以将古籍中的文字内容提取出来,存储在数据库中,方便学者进行研究和分析。
3、票据和发票的管理
在企业的票据和发票管理过程中,常常需要对大量的票据和发票进行处理和管理。通过OCR技术,可以将票据和发票中的文字内容提取出来,并进行结构化存储和分析。例如,可以将发票上的文字内容提取出来,存储在数据库中,方便财务人员进行查询和核对。
七、前瞻性的技术和趋势
随着技术的发展,未来在编辑图片中的数据库方面,可能会有更多的技术和趋势出现。
1、深度学习和人工智能
深度学习和人工智能技术在OCR领域的应用,将进一步提高文字识别的准确性和效率。例如,使用卷积神经网络(CNN)和循环神经网络(RNN)可以实现对复杂图像和手写文字的高精度识别。
2、区块链技术
区块链技术在数据安全和隐私保护方面具有独特的优势。通过将数据存储在区块链上,可以确保数据的不可篡改和可追溯性,提高数据的安全性和可信性。
3、云计算和大数据
云计算和大数据技术在数据存储和处理方面具有巨大的优势。通过将数据存储在云端,可以实现数据的高效存储和管理;通过大数据技术,可以对大量数据进行快速分析和处理,挖掘数据中的价值。
八、总结
编辑图片中的数据库是一项复杂而重要的任务,涉及到多种技术和方法。通过使用OCR技术,可以高效地将图片中的文字内容提取出来,并进行编辑和管理;通过手动输入数据和使用专业的软件进行图像处理,可以提高数据的准确性和可用性;通过结合多种方法,可以提高工作效率和数据的准确性;通过数据安全和隐私保护措施,可以确保数据的安全性和隐私性;通过实际案例的分析,可以更好地理解和应用这些技术和方法;通过前瞻性的技术和趋势,可以预见未来在这一领域的发展和应用。
相关问答FAQs:
1. 图片中的数据库是指什么?
图片中的数据库通常是指图片中嵌入的数据或元数据,这些数据可以包含图片的描述、来源、作者、时间等信息。
2. 如何提取图片中的数据库?
要提取图片中的数据库,您可以使用专业的图像处理软件或元数据提取工具。这些工具可以帮助您分析图片的元数据,并提取出其中的数据库信息。
3. 如何编辑图片中的数据库?
要编辑图片中的数据库,您可以使用图像处理软件或元数据编辑工具。这些工具通常提供了编辑元数据的功能,您可以根据需要修改图片中的数据库信息,如修改图片的描述、作者等。请确保在编辑之前备份原始图片,以防止意外丢失数据。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/1838090